Under the Sea / Little Mermaid Party

Here is an Under the Sea party we had for my daughter last year.  She loves the Little Mermaid but we were inviting boys to the party too so we choose Under the Sea as the primary theme.

The Food:

· Octopus on Seaweed – which were hot dogs on top of spaghetti that was dyed green.

· Mock Sushi – rice cereal with fruit leather strips

· Goldfish

· Crab dip and crackers

· Blue ocean punch

The Decorations:

· Blue and green balloons hanging from ceiling to give an ocean effect

· Blue and green streams

· Ariel, sea creatures and streamers

· Fish netting with ocean creatures

The Activities:

· Decorating door hangers and sea creature masks

· Sand art

· Water Balloons

  • Pinata

The kids enjoyed the water games and the cake! It was another fun and exciting birthday!

Dora Birthday Party

Come on!  Vamanos!

So here is a short birthday from the past.  We had a Dora birthday for my daughter’s 2nd birthday.

I made backpacks from felt for all of the kids.  When they arrived they were greeted with the backpack and a map inside that I made for the party.  We had a Dora adventure using the map. It consisted of:

1)  Backpack Brain Teaser – They had to feel inside a backpack and figure out the objects that were in there.

2)  Maraca Mountain – A table set up with maraca’s for everyone to decorate.

3)  Musical Valley – A version of musical chairs but using print outs of characters from Dora to stand on.

4)  Blindfold Forest – There were treats hidden in the back yard for the kids to find

5) Pinata Playground – We ended with the big Dora pinata.

Food – We had mexican food to go with the dora theme.  On the tables I set out chips and salsa, tortilla roll-ups, and dora fruit snacks.  For lunch, we had enchiladas and beans.

It turned out to be a great fiesta with a lot of food and fun!
